1. Fill in the chart to define negative control and positive control in terms of how the active forms of the gene regulatory proteins function. How does an inducer turn on a gene that is negatively controlled? How does an inducer turn on a gene that is positively controlled? Explain how a product turns off a negatively controlled gene, and how it turns off a positively controlled gene. Provide an example of each. (4pt)

Explanation / Answer
Negative - function of inducer - the inducer bind to repressor which inhibit it binding it to operator thus on the gene .
Function of product - the product as the inhibitor of the gene which off the gene
Example lac operon
Positive - function of inducer - it bind to activator which activate activator to bind to dna . function of product - inhibit the gene and turn it off.
